There were times in this podcast when th dead air stretched out before us like a highway cutting through th Canadian wilderness. Billy Ray Stupendous and I were cool w/ it as we emulated th chillness of our esteemed Canadian guests, Toronto's Phil B and Winnipeg's Michael Dwilow, who hold court on th greatness, th bashfulness, th emotional weirdness, and th relative invisibility of th land known to people in my neighbourhood as "Canadia". Listen as Billy and I indulge in a nostalgic callback to our shared coming-of-age to Allan Moyle's Pump Up th Volume (1990). (Yes, Moyle is Canadian.) Learn th fate of th Loyalists from th American Revolution. Slap yr own head in astonishment as one of th world's most beloved superheroes is outed. Picture Chester Brown's m-bation technique. Surrender to th feeling that something's off about a famous person you admire -- that's right, it's because they're from Canadia
